THE Autonomous Region of Bougainville Rugby Union sevens squad are on schedule for the Kokopo PNG Games.
Coach Peter Tsiamalili Jr announced a strong squad last week that includes two sevens internationals Hubert Tseraha and Chris Kakah, and exciting new find from the islands Tauri Moore.
The squad were picked and established after the Independence Sevens tournament run by Bougainville Rugby Union, with an average of 23 years across the board.
 “I’m happy with the squad and this is what we will go with before we travel,” Tsiamalili said.
“The PNG Games is the pinnacle for any grassroots sportsman or woman. For Bougainville rugby, this is a great opportunity for us to compete against all 22 provinces in the sport, something that you don’t get to do on the regular sevens circuits.
“The goal is for gold, but our focus is to do better than we did in the last games in Port Moresby, a better placing.”
The squad received a K10,000 sponsorship from long-term Bougainville rugby sponsor Bougainville Rugby Consults for part of their levies, and playing gears.
Tsiamalili thanked the managing director Bob Willis for the ongoing support. He also acknowledged the support of Beachside Brasserie, Tuboin Ltd, Reasons Bar & Grill, Naiaga Trading, Wedlyn Bus Services, Eagle Hardware and Axxelarate ‘Kooga’ Sports Marketing.
The AROB team: Jimmy Pahia, Tsitom Semoso, Charlie Keriaka, Nathan Baramun, Tseraha, Brethren Junior Kenu, Duncan Fama, Kakah, Moore, Eric Kaiat, Virgil Kilkil Baraho, Ben Oakley, Clive Tsigo, and Joey Masiu. Kelly Havara is assistant coach and Gideon Tongo manager.
